logo

GaitEdge:重新定义步态识别的实用边界

作者:狼烟四起2025.09.23 14:38浏览量:0

简介:本文深度解析GaitEdge如何突破传统端到端步态识别局限,通过边缘感知建模、多模态融合及动态场景优化技术,实现97.3%的识别准确率与跨场景泛化能力提升,为安防、医疗、零售等领域提供高鲁棒性解决方案。

一、传统步态识别的技术瓶颈与GaitEdge的创新突破

传统端到端步态识别系统普遍存在三大技术缺陷:静态特征依赖导致动态场景适应性差,单一模态输入限制复杂环境下的鲁棒性,黑箱模型结构难以满足安全合规需求。以某银行网点部署的步态识别系统为例,在人群密集、光照突变场景下,误识率高达12%,且无法提供可解释的决策依据。

GaitEdge通过三项核心技术实现突破性创新:

  1. 边缘感知动态建模:采用时空图卷积网络(ST-GCN)结合光流特征,构建动态骨骼点序列。实验表明,该模型在CASIA-B数据集上的跨视角识别准确率提升至96.8%,较传统方法提高14.2%。

    1. # ST-GCN核心代码示例
    2. class ST_GCN(nn.Module):
    3. def __init__(self, in_channels, out_channels, adj):
    4. super().__init__()
    5. self.conv = nn.Conv2d(in_channels, out_channels, kernel_size=(3,1))
    6. self.adj = adj # 动态构建的骨骼拓扑图
    7. def forward(self, x):
    8. # x: [batch, channel, time, joint]
    9. x = self.conv(x)
    10. x = torch.einsum('nctv,vw->nctw', x, self.adj) # 动态图卷积
    11. return x
  2. 多模态特征融合:创新性地引入毫米波雷达与RGB-D数据,通过跨模态注意力机制实现特征互补。在TUM-GAIT数据集测试中,融合模型在雨天场景下的识别准确率达94.7%,较纯视觉方案提升28.3%。

  3. 可解释性增强设计:采用Grad-CAM++可视化技术生成热力图,清晰展示模型关注的人体关节区域。某机场安检系统部署后,审计通过率提升至100%,完全满足民航安全认证要求。

二、动态场景下的技术优化实践

(一)跨视角识别增强方案

针对监控摄像头安装角度差异问题,GaitEdge开发了三维姿态重建模块:

  1. 通过Weak Perspective Projection模型将2D关节点映射到3D空间
  2. 采用ICP算法进行点云配准,消除视角差异
  3. 实验显示,在0°-90°视角变化范围内,识别准确率波动控制在±1.5%以内

(二)复杂光照处理策略

开发自适应光照补偿算法,包含三个处理阶段:

  1. 预处理层:基于Retinex理论的动态范围压缩
  2. 特征层:光照不变描述子(ILD)提取
  3. 决策层:光照条件分类器动态加权
    在极端光照测试中(照度<10lux),系统仍保持92.1%的识别准确率。

(三)实时性能优化方案

通过三项技术实现1080P视频流的实时处理:

  1. 模型量化:将FP32权重转为INT8,推理速度提升3.2倍
  2. 多线程调度:采用CUDA流并行处理视频帧
  3. 硬件加速:集成TensorRT优化引擎
    在NVIDIA Jetson AGX Xavier平台上,系统吞吐量达120FPS,延迟<80ms。

三、典型行业应用解决方案

(一)智慧安防场景

为某省级监狱部署的解决方案包含:

  1. 双目摄像头阵列:覆盖15米监控半径
  2. 人员轨迹追踪:基于步态特征的跨摄像头重识别
  3. 异常行为检测:结合步态周期分析的摔倒检测
    系统运行6个月来,误报率降低至0.3次/天,较传统方案提升87%。

(二)医疗康复领域

开发的步态分析系统具备:

  1. 关节活动度测量:精度达±1.5°
  2. 对称性评估:计算左右侧步态参数差异
  3. 康复进度追踪:生成可视化报告
    在300例术后患者跟踪中,系统评估结果与医师判断一致性达91.2%。

(三)新零售应用

某连锁超市部署的客流分析系统实现:

  1. 无感身份识别:顾客无需驻足
  2. 动线热力图:精准分析购物路径
  3. 停留时长统计:误差<0.5秒
    试点门店数据显示,系统帮助优化货架布局后,客单价提升18.7%。

四、开发者实践指南

(一)模型部署建议

  1. 边缘设备选型

    • 轻量级场景:Jetson Nano(4GB)
    • 中等规模:Jetson Xavier NX
    • 大型系统:Tesla T4服务器
  2. 数据采集规范

    • 采样率:≥25fps
    • 分辨率:≥640×480
    • 背景复杂度:<30%动态物体

(二)性能调优技巧

  1. 输入预处理优化
    1. # 高效预处理代码示例
    2. def preprocess(frame):
    3. # 灰度转换
    4. gray = cv2.cvtColor(frame, cv2.COLOR_BGR2GRAY)
    5. # 直方图均衡化
    6. clahe = cv2.createCLAHE(clipLimit=2.0, tileGridSize=(8,8))
    7. enhanced = clahe.apply(gray)
    8. # 高斯模糊降噪
    9. blurred = cv2.GaussianBlur(enhanced, (5,5), 0)
    10. return blurred
  2. 模型压缩方案
    • 通道剪枝:移除<5%权重的通道
    • 知识蒸馏:用Teacher-Student架构训练轻量模型
    • 量化感知训练:保持FP32精度训练INT8模型

(三)错误处理机制

  1. 异常检测

    • 输入尺寸校验
    • 关节点置信度阈值(>0.7)
    • 运动连续性检查
  2. 容错设计

    • 多模型投票机制
    • 备用特征提取路径
    • 自动重试机制(最多3次)

五、技术演进方向

当前GaitEdge 2.0版本正在研发三项创新:

  1. 无监督域适应:解决跨数据集性能下降问题
  2. 联邦学习框架:支持多机构数据协同训练
  3. 轻量化3D检测:基于MonoDepth2的实时深度估计

实验数据显示,无监督域适应技术可使模型在新场景下的冷启动准确率提升41%,联邦学习方案在保持数据隐私的前提下,使模型泛化能力提升27%。

GaitEdge通过系统性技术创新,不仅突破了传统步态识别的技术瓶颈,更构建了完整的实用化解决方案。从核心算法优化到行业应用落地,从边缘设备部署到云端协同,GaitEdge为开发者提供了全栈式技术支撑。随着3D感知、多模态融合等技术的持续演进,步态识别正在从实验室走向真实世界,为智慧城市、医疗健康、商业分析等领域创造巨大价值。对于开发者而言,掌握GaitEdge技术体系,意味着在计算机视觉领域获得新的竞争优势;对于企业用户来说,部署GaitEdge解决方案,则是提升安全水平、优化运营效率的明智之选。

相关文章推荐

发表评论